Focal varieties of curves of genus 6 and 8

Abstract

In this paper we give a simple Torelli type theorem for curves of genus 6 and 8 by showing that these curves can be reconstructed from their Brill Noether varieties. Among other results, it is shown that the focal variety of a general, canonical and nonhyperelliptic curve of genus 6, is a hypersurface.
